Navigating Taiwan import tax and customs regulations
When the sneakers are ready to leave the US, you must consider the local regulations in Taiwan. The Ministry of Finance applies import duties and customs tax on imported goods that exceed a value of 2,000 TWD. Since the Nike x Bode Astro Grabber is a premium item, it will likely fall into this category. You should be prepared to pay the applicable import tax upon the arrival of the package.
Additionally, you should review the list of prohibited items to ensure your shipment complies with all shipping rules. While sneakers are generally safe to ship, certain cleaning kits or pressurized shoe care products included in some limited editions might be restricted.
